空客火速修复大部分A320软件故障 避免重蹈波音(BA.US)覆辙
Zhi Tong Cai Jing· 2025-12-01 09:05
该公司表示:"对于此次事件给乘客和航空公司带来的任何不便和延误,我们深表歉意。" 所涉及的这款软件用于控制飞机的升降舵和副翼计算机——即ELAC2系统。空客发现,在10月30日的 一次航班中,一架捷蓝航空公司的客机上该系统出现了故障。该制造商表示,故障原因是"强烈的太阳 辐射",这种现象可能会导致电子系统出现意想不到的异常情况。 此次召回事件凸显了空客对安全和预防措施的高度重视,因为对于飞机来说,控制软件系统极为重要, 事关飞行安全。几年前,波音(BA.US)就遭遇了飞机机载系统出现故障带来的严重后果。2018年末和 2019年初,两架737Max型飞机(与空客A320相竞争的机型)接连发生坠毁事故。后来发现,一种名 为"MCAS"的稳定控制系统在飞行过程中发送了错误指令,致使飞行员陷入混乱,最终导致了两架飞机 上的人员全部丧生的惨剧。 空客表示,在约6000架受软件故障影响的A320系列飞机中,绝大多数已于周末完成了必要的修复工 作。这使得这家欧洲飞机制造商得以避免出现更广泛的停飞情况,这也是该公司迄今为止规模最大的一 次召回事件。 空客周一在一份声明中表示,仍有不到100架飞机需要安装软件修复程序才能重新 ...
约6000架空客A320客机需紧急停飞
Xin Hua She· 2025-11-29 11:27
Core Viewpoint - Airbus has announced an urgent grounding of a significant number of A320 series aircraft due to flight control software vulnerabilities to strong solar radiation, affecting approximately 6,000 aircraft [1] Group 1: Incident Details - A recent incident involving an A320 aircraft from JetBlue Airways resulted in a sudden altitude drop during flight, injuring several passengers [1] - The flight was en route from Cancun International Airport in Mexico to Newark Airport in New Jersey, and made an emergency landing in Tampa International Airport, Florida [1] Group 2: Impact on Operations - Airlines including Air France, easyJet, American Airlines, JetBlue Airways, and Air New Zealand have reported potential flight cancellations or delays due to the grounding [1] - Most A320 aircraft can revert to a previous software version unaffected by solar radiation within "a few hours," while about 1,000 aircraft will require hardware replacements, expected to take several weeks [1] Group 3: Historical Context - Since its introduction in 1988, the Airbus A320 series has delivered a total of 12,260 aircraft, surpassing the long-standing record held by Boeing's 737 series [2]

霍尼韦尔携手中国飞协 共促航电技术提升飞行安全
Zheng Quan Ri Bao Wang· 2025-11-22 03:42
Core Insights - The third Aviation Electronics Technology for Flight Safety Seminar was successfully held in Hangzhou, focusing on enhancing flight safety through discussions on key topics such as GPS interference, high-altitude operations, runway safety technology, and interconnected radar [1] Group 1: Event Overview - The seminar was organized by the China Civil Aviation Pilots Association and hosted by Honeywell Aerospace, bringing together leaders and technical pilots from domestic and international airlines [1] - The event has evolved into a significant platform for interaction among pilots, operational experts, and avionics engineers, promoting practical applications and experience sharing in avionics technology [1] Group 2: Honeywell's Contributions - Honeywell showcased its new ground warning software, SURF-A, which acts as an enhanced ground proximity warning system, helping pilots identify runway hazards and take corrective actions [2] - The SURF-A software integrates with SmartRunway and SmartLanding technologies, highlighting Honeywell's integrated advantages and scalability in runway safety products [2] - Honeywell emphasizes that technological innovation and industry collaboration are essential for ensuring flight safety, aiming to align global avionics technology with the operational needs of Chinese civil aviation [2]

安全事故频出,737 MAX机型将被替代?波音已开始研发一款新的窄体飞机
Mei Ri Jing Ji Xin Wen· 2025-09-30 07:41
Group 1: Boeing's New Aircraft Development - Boeing has begun developing a new narrow-body aircraft to replace the 737 MAX series, aiming to rebuild its market position and compete with Airbus [1] - Boeing's CEO, Kelly Ortberg, met with Rolls-Royce executives earlier this year to discuss potential collaboration on new engines for the aircraft [1] Group 2: Safety and Reputation Issues - Boeing has faced multiple safety incidents in recent years, damaging its reputation and marketing performance [3] - The company has been criticized for prioritizing profit over engineering excellence, particularly after acquiring McDonnell Douglas in 1997, leading to rushed product launches like the 737 MAX [3] Group 3: Financial Performance - Boeing reported a significant decline in revenue and aircraft deliveries, with a net loss of approximately $11.8 billion for the year [5] - In Q2 2024, Boeing's revenue was $22.75 billion, a 35% increase from $16.87 billion in the same period last year, while the net loss was $612 million, an improvement from a loss of $1.44 billion in Q2 2023 [6] Group 4: Regulatory and Legal Challenges - Boeing's financial losses were partly due to a settlement with the U.S. Department of Justice related to two fatal crashes involving the 737 MAX, costing the company $445 million [6] - The company is facing fines of approximately $3.1 million from the FAA for safety violations identified between September 2023 and February 2024 [7] Group 5: Market Position and Stock Performance - Boeing's certification work for the 737 MAX 7 and MAX 10 models is now expected to be delayed until 2026 [9] - As of September 29, Boeing's stock price was $217.08 per share, having halved since its peak in 2019 [9]
